    What is Halwa Puri?

    Halwa Puri is a traditional South Asian dish that combines two beloved foods: Halwa and Puri. Halwa is a sweet dessert made from semolina, sugar, ghee, and sometimes nuts. Puri, on the other hand, is a deep-fried flatbread that’s crispy on the outside and soft on the inside. Together, they create a perfect balance of flavors that’s both sweet and savory.

    This dish is often served with a side of yogurt or chutney to balance out the sweetness. It’s a favorite among people of all ages and is commonly enjoyed during festivals and special occasions. But you don’t have to wait for a special event to enjoy it—Halwa Puri is available year-round in many places.

    The History of Halwa Puri

    The origins of Halwa Puri can be traced back to the Indian subcontinent, where street food culture thrives. Halwa has been a part of South Asian cuisine for centuries, with its roots in Persian and Middle Eastern influences. Puri, on the other hand, is a staple in Indian cuisine and has been enjoyed for generations.

    The combination of the two became popular in the 20th century, especially in Pakistan and Northern India. Over time, it evolved into the dish we know and love today. It’s not just a meal; it’s a cultural symbol that represents the rich culinary heritage of the region.

    Types of Halwa Puri

    Not all Halwa Puri is created equal. There are several variations of this dish, each with its own unique flavor profile. Here are some of the most popular types:

    • Gajar Halwa Puri: Made with carrot Halwa, this version is packed with nutrients and flavor.
    • Sooji Halwa Puri: Using semolina as the base, this classic version is a crowd favorite.
    • Mohan Halwa Puri: A rich and creamy version that’s perfect for special occasions.
    • Atte Ka Halwa Puri: Made with wheat flour, this version is hearty and filling.

    Each type offers a different experience, so it’s worth trying them all to see which one you like best!
